Limestone Countertops NJ

Limestone is a very common and well-known sedimentary rock that is widely used for various purposes, including construction. The popularity of limestone is due to the fact that it is very easy to process and at the same time has quite good properties.

Limestone is currently being mined in colossal quantities. Moreover, it can have a very different color, including black, although it is worth noting that most often this breed is either gray or white.

How is Limestone Formed?

It would be meaningless to speak about the greatness of this stone without highlighting the unique and beautiful process through which every limestone is formed. And the awesome lighter colors of every slab can only offer a little glimpse of this.

Behind every excellent limestone Countertop, therefore, is a profound story that spans several millennia. Thousands or perhaps millions of years ago when some now-extinct sea creatures died, their skeletons accumulated deep in the sea, forming the limestones. That’s why it’s perfectly reasonable to sometimes stumble upon a non-fossilized shell of an antiquated creature embedded into the stone itself.

Qualities of Limestone to Consider when Shopping

All limestone stones are porous, and the degree on varies according to the hardness of the stone. However, it’s recommended that if you are shopping for some for your limestone countertop NJ, then buy one that’s properly sealed. Also, don’t go for something that would act like a sponge as it would stain quickly.

Other than using it on your kitchen countertop, a limestone counter can be erected to accent stone in your bathroom or elsewhere that it would be appropriate. Its soft, sensual color and design are enough to make your house look neat and charming.

However, limestone demands high maintenance because it’s porous.

Limestone, when it’s fresh from the quarry, is remarkably durable, but once it’s cut for your use, the overall level of durability gets reduced. That’s why we highly encourage buyers to get proper pieces of advice before purchasing any particular limestone slab.

Also, any finish chosen lies in how hard stone is. Harder limestone countertops NJ typically have a more glossy, polished finish and a beautiful look.

Natural limestone is one of the most popular and affordable materials, as it has unique properties:

  • strength and homogeneity of the structure;
  • resistance to abrasion and weathering.

In addition, this stone lends itself well to processing, therefore, magnificent elements of architecture (cornices, columns, balusters, as well as fireplaces and window sills) are made from it.
